ALCOHOL ABUSE DETERRENT PROGRAM INC, founded in 1989, is a small nonprofit in the Crime & Legal sector that reported $541K in total revenue in fiscal year 2024. Revenue fell 21% from the prior year — a significant decline worth monitoring. Expenses of $649K exceeded revenue, resulting in a 20% operating deficit.

Mission

THE ALCOHOL ABUSE DETERRENT PROGRAM IS DESIGNED TO PROVIDE AN ALTERNATIVE TO INCARCERATION FOR REPEAT DRUNK DRIVING OFFENDERS. CURRENTLY, APPROXIMATELY 250 PARTICIPANTS ARE IN THE PROGRAM RECEIVING WEEKLY ANTABUSE OR BREATH TESTS.
